Nvidia Ion Turbocharges Intel Atom 155566-pico_ion_180I'm going to give you the same advice I'm currently giving to all my buddies: Unless you absolutely need a sub-$500 portable right now, wait.
Imagine a netbook
that can actually play modern first-person shooter games. Or a tiny
$500 PC that can quickly encode video. It's possible--I just saw it
with my own two eyes. nVidia recently came in to show off its two-chip
Ion platform, which marries an Intel Atom CPU with nVidia's 94000M
graphics processing unit. Honestly, the results surprised me.
Let
me back up for a second. I've been complaining that, as neat as
netbooks may be, I'm not buying one until their makers replace their
lame integrated graphics. I want to play games that are a little more
sophisticated than Peggle, and to watch good-quality video on the
machine's 10.2-inch screen. And that's exactly what's happening here....
